Lead Polysomnography Technologist - Full Time Job Category: Patient Services Requisition Number: LEADP002682 Posted: June 5, 2026 Full-Time On-site Indiana, PA 15701, USA Job Details In this role you will be:
Perform routine and complex polysomnographic procedures including setup, monitoring, data acquisition, and scoring. Ensure patient safety, comfort, and satisfaction during overnight sleep studies. Review patient histories and confirm appropriate test selection and protocols. Accurately score sleep studies in accordance with AASM guidelines. Troubleshoot and resolve equipment and signal issues in real-time. Provide day-to-day supervision and support for technologists and technicians. Schedule staff coverage to ensure adequate lab operations across all shifts. Serve as a mentor and resource for staff; lead training and onboarding for new hires. Conduct performance feedback and assist with competency assessments. Ensure compliance with hospital policies, HIPAA regulations, and infection control procedures. Monitor and maintain the quality and integrity of sleep study data. Assist in maintaining accreditation standards (e.g., AASM or Joint Commission). Collaborate with sleep physicians and medical director on protocol updates and clinical workflow improvements. Coordinate maintenance and calibration of equipment; report technical issues promptly. Participate in audits, data collection, and quality improvement initiatives.

Duties, responsibilities, and activities may change at any time with or without notice. Qualifications:
Education: Successful completion of a polysomnography program recognized by the BRPT, associated with a State licensed and/or a nationally accredited educational facility is preferred. Boarded as a Registered Polysomnographic Technologist is required upon application. All continuing education requirements must be completed according to applicable governing body. Experience: 3-5 years of paid clinical experience where the on-the-job duties of polysomnography are performed is required. Licensure/Certification: Registry by the Board of Registered Polysomnographic Technologist required. Must be BLS certified required (or obtain within one month of hire).
